Zadar Archipelago Small Group Island Tour

This small group tour visits three unique islands in the Zadar Archipelago, perfect for friends, couples, and families seeking a relaxed day exploring car-free islands.

Highlights

  • Small group tour with a maximum of 12 guests
  • Explore islands with no cars, pollution, or crowds
  • Swim in crystal clear seas and sandy lagoons
  • Discover the story of the Toreta Tower on Silba Island
  • Meet locals and experience unique island culture and history

Description

The tour includes 4 to 5 stops featuring 5 to 6 activities such as ball games in shallow waters, snorkeling among wild fish, island walks, sightseeing, and relaxing at beach bars.

The itinerary is carefully tailored to avoid crowds and rush hours, offering unconventional routes to private islands, turquoise lagoons, and sandy beaches.

An experienced, local English-speaking captain and guide lead the tour with an individual approach, ensuring a relaxed and private atmosphere. The comfortable and safe boat operates in all weather conditions.

This full-day experience has been offered since 2015 by a highly rated operator with over 30,000 satisfied guests.
